User comments regarding the phone number (866) 932-6821 indicate possible concerns over spam or scam activity, particularly relating to potential identity theft and deceptive debt collection practices. Many users describe unsolicited calls asking for personal information linked to military banking. There are differing views on whether it is a legitimate debt collection or a malicious attempt, with strong warnings to avoid sharing any personal details.

In analyzing FCC complaint metrics over the decade from 2014 to 2024, notable shifts were observed. Complaints regarding wireless/mobile communication methods peaked in 2017, while wired communication complaints saw their highest in 2015, indicating varying consumer experiences. VOIP complaints reached their summit in 2019, highlighting newer communication concerns. Call types also played a role, with prerecorded voice complaints most frequent in 2019 and live voice issues hitting their zenith in 2015. Text message complaints came into prominence in 2022. There has been a marked increase in unwanted call complaints beginning in 2016, showing heightened consumer attention towards telemarketing, which maxed out in 2015, as robocall reports noticeably shrank post-2016.
